我应该在使用源代码控制时推送我的依赖项(jar库)

时间:2013-03-11 10:11:59

标签: java git google-app-engine github

通常当我不使用maven时,我的项目有大量的库文件 例如,普通GAE将具有至少40MB的jar文件

我应该避免将此文件推送到存储库吗?(以及如何避免它) 如果没有,我该如何处理这种情况(有些事情,我的网络真的很慢)

2 个答案:

答案 0 :(得分:1)

GAE罐子本身非常大,所以如果你把罐子推到git并更新它们几次你的回购会变得非常大。 我们仍然使用像Maven这样的东西来处理依赖关系。

答案 1 :(得分:0)

将所有jar依赖项推送到repo,以便您的项目是自包含的。

40 MB不是那么大的空间,你只需要推一次这些罐子 - 它们不会经常更新。